New YouGov Welsh poll
There is a new YouGov poll of Welsh assembly voting intentions for ITV. The topline figures, with changes from the last monthly poll, are as follows:
Constituency: CON 19%(-3), LAB 44%(nc), LDEM 9%(-2), PC 21%(+2) Regional: CON 18%(-2), LAB 40%(-1), LDEM 9%(-3), PC 23%(+4)
At both regional and constituency level Plaid take second place from the Conservatives. On a uniform swing (and assuming Labour retake Blaenau Gwent now Trish Law is standing down) this would result in the Conservatives losing 4 of their 5 constituency seats to Labour (Monmouth would be the only hold). Add on the regional seats, where the Conservatives would get back some of the seats they lost at a constituency level, and the final result would be Conservatives 10 seats (down 2), Labour 31 seats (up 5), Lib Dems 5 (down 1), Plaid 14 (down 1) - giving Labour an overall majority for the first time.
